JioCinema and Tinder have joined forces to bring viewers an exclusive series called ‘Swipe Ride’ on JioCinema, India’s leading digital entertainment platform. This highly anticipated show, produced by Viacom18 Digital Ventures, focuses on the dating experiences of Indian women and their pursuit of autonomy in the dating world. Starting from July 7th, the first episode featuring Uorfi Javed will be available for free streaming on JioCinema.
As per the Press release, in ‘Swipe Ride,’ popular social media content creator and actor, Kusha Kapila, returns as the host, chauffeuring Tinder members to their dates. Accompanying them on their journey is a surprise celebrity guest.
Together, they engage in meaningful conversations about the intricacies of dating, romance, relationship expectations, and how Tinder facilitates different types of connections.
Taru Kapoor, GM of Tinder and Match Group India, stated, ‘Swipe Ride’ celebrates the diverse perspectives of young Indian women and their dating journeys in a relatable context. This series encourages open dialogues about self-care, financial independence, dating autonomy, and the freedom to make choices. Young women who are actively dating are sharing their honest and transparent experiences, demonstrating the courage to explore various possibilities.”
